The source code is included - even though you probably don't realize
it.There is a utility that will unpack the kit and reveal the source
code. Then you can fix it, pack it back up and run it.Google for
sdx.kit and tclkit and equi4 and you will find the details. It's a
tcl/tk program.

I just updated the current viewer to version 0.35.
I added the remaining time display.
The default server is the 19x19 server, so if you use it for 9x9 you must
specify the server and port. You must use the options like this:
cgosview -server server_name -port portnum -games
By the way - if you are running 32 bit linux, some tclkit's have
better fonts than others.
I use one called tclkit-linux-x86-xft
Which looks much nicer. I don't remember where I got it.
